Output 3f24c0cfc0909de8316af207049bf795a59c589e21a024e8759195c624c5fc19:4

value
2656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ae86eaf016c444386e75164a3e17978ed75f9c OP_EQUAL
address
DBapv35cpvASria8Jvnks3Fy2Rwoo9GJu9
transaction
3f24c0cfc0909de8316af207049bf795a59c589e21a024e8759195c624c5fc19
spent
true